POD + HASBRO
SUMMER DESIGN STUDIO
See many more pictures from our amazing week with Hasbro on our Facebook page:

Each morning for during our second week-long Summer Design Studio, Hasbro designers came to the POD studio to share their story and their professional work with POD teens. Through presentations, demonstrations, design challenges and interactions with designers, teens uncovered the entire design process, from brainstorming and sketching to production, marketing and presenting. In the afternoons, teens worked with these new found skills to create their own toy or game. By the end of the week each teen had developed their very own product and presented it to the group. Their presentations and final products were truly impressive. We even fit in a tour of Hasbro! Many thanks to everyone at the Hasbro team who took the time to share their passion for their work, and to Christine Enos, POD's teaching artist who guided the teens in their own making journey. POD Programming Fall 2018
September is a busy but exciting time of year as the school year speeds up and the weather cools down. This fall POD will be running two after-school programs for partner schools, Charles E. Shea High School in Pawtucket and for Woonsocket High School .

Additionally, we will be adding another section to our Saturday Portfolio program, this strategic move enables us serve to serve 75 teens, increased from 50, from approximately 15 public and public charter high schools in our target area.

We will also be working in partnership with the Department of Teaching + Learning in Art + Design (TLAD) and RISD's Nature Lab in bringing unique school-day programming to teens from The Met School in Providence. POD and RISD also welcomes a great cohort of MA and MATs in the Department of Teaching + Learning in Art + Design who will work with POD in a variety of ways throughout their year at RISD.

RISD PRECOLLEGE
HASBRO SUMMER SCHOLARS
Congratulations to POD teens Danny Svay and Keegan Bonds-Harmon who both attend The Metropolitan Career and Technical Center in Providence for surviving and thriving in RISD's PreCollege program this summer. Danny and Keegan were awarded full scholarships to attend this intensive 6-week program as part of generous grant support from Hasbro . Danny majored in Animation and Keegan in Painting. They both really enjoyed their experiences and created some amazing work over the summer!
